3. Customization and OEM/ODM Services

If you are an interior designer or a brand wanting unique fixtures, look for a company that offers customization. Many top-tier pendant lighting wholesale companies provide O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) and ODM (Original Design Manufacturer) services. This enables you to have lights designed to your exact specifications—ideal for creating a signature interior look or branded lighting collection.

4. Quality Control and Certification

Reputable wholesale companies conduct strict quality control checks before shipping. High-grade materials, long-lasting LED components, and durable finishes are prioritized. Additionally, the company should comply with international safety and energy efficiency standards such as CE, RoHS, or UL certifications depending on the destination market.

Choosing a certified wholesale supplier minimizes the risk of returns, safety issues, or customer dissatisfaction.

Applications of Pendant Lighting in Design

Pendant lighting has evolved from being purely functional to a central design element. Here are some spaces where pendant lights are commonly used:

  • Residential Kitchens – Hanging above islands or counters for task lighting and aesthetics.

  • Dining Areas – Statement pendants to create a focal point.

  • Retail Stores – Enhancing product displays and customer experience.

  • Offices & Reception Areas – Modern pendant clusters add sophistication.

  • Hospitality Projects – Hotels and restaurants rely on custom pendants for ambiance.
